GENERAL DESCRIPTION

The Connection 2 Care (C2C) Program Manager oversees the outreach, counseling, navigational, and case management services to recently released prisoners including those affected by chronic diseases, substance use (SU) and/or mental health issues who present at or are referred to the Connection 2 Care Program (C2C) at MyCare Health Center. The Program Manager serves as the primary point of contact for the Community Health Worker (CHW) and Carceral Authorities.

They will work together to maintain appropriate contact to send and receive protected health information for prospective released prisoners.

SPECIFIC DUTIES

The program manager plays a critical role in the implementation and operationalizing the C2C program including supporting community health workers (CHWs) by providing organizational, operational, and strategic oversight.

  • Provide administrative oversight of the program and is the primary contact for carceral authorities to refer returning citizens to the program.
  • Single central point of contact to facilitate information exchange.
  • Coordinate and schedule in-reach and initial assessment activities; conduct in-reach activities as appropriate.
  • Develop and formalize community partnerships.
  • Coordinate and facilitate the Advisory Council membership and meetings.
  • Facilitate ongoing all staff training to support justice involved patients who are returning to the community.
  • Collaborate with the Director of Quality and Compliance to track and record evaluative measures.

For the specific duties outlined in the CHW role, the program manager would:

  • Oversee the day‑to‑day activities of CHWs, offering guidance and ensuring they have the resources and training necessary to support returning citizens. They ensure that CHWs understand and can implement evidence‑based practices in their work.
  • Facilitate ongoing training opportunities for CHWs, ensuring they are up‑to‑date with the latest practices and evidence‑based care models, including education about the healthcare system, chronic illness management, and case management.
  • Ensure CHWs have the tools, technology, and support to document work effectively (e.g., maintaining appropriate records, handling referrals, and following up with patients). This includes securing access to any necessary community resources and supporting CHWs in facilitating these connections for patients.
  • Provide strategic support for the CHWs’ community outreach and recruitment efforts. This includes collaborating with community partners to strengthen the outreach process and ensure that CHWs are engaging with the appropriate individuals in prisons, jails, and local communities.
  • Ensure that CHWs are working effectively with clinic partners and other stakeholders in the network. This might involve facilitating interagency meetings, building relationships with key partners, and ensuring that the program aligns with community needs and resources.
  • Monitor the performance of the CHWs, evaluating the effectiveness of interventions and tracking progress towards program goals. The program manager ensures that data related to patient outcomes, referrals, and resource access is gathered, analyzed, and used for continuous improvement.
  • Coordinate with other team members (such as healthcare providers, social workers, and administrative staff) to ensure that the CHWs’ activities align with the overall goals of the clinic or program. This includes regular team meetings and check‑ins to address challenges and maintain open lines of communication.
  • Serve as an advocate for the CHWs within the organization and the broader community. The program manager helps to establish strong relationships with key stakeholders, ensuring that the CHWs’ role is understood and valued. They may also help with securing funding or partnerships to support CHWs in their work.
  • Provide problem‑solving support for CHWs when they encounter difficulties in their work, whether they are related to patient cases, community dynamics, or logistical challenges. The program manager ensures that CHWs are not left to face these issues alone.
